Green Building Specialist (Multifamily)

The Position and the Team
The Residential Building Services team at SWA is seeking a professional to support sustainable multifamily building design and construction. The ideal candidate will have excellent communication skills, a passion for improving the built environment, and experience with multifamily design and construction. Tasks include reviewing architectural and mechanical system design; inspecting and testing buildings under construction; and documenting energy/green measures to help new multifamily projects achieve green certification (LEED Multifamily Midrise, Enterprise Green Communities, National Green Building Standard, ENERGY STAR), meet local sustainability and energy codes, and qualify for incentives.

Primary Responsibilities:
  1. Articulate building science principles and sustainability requirements to all project stakeholders.
  2. Review construction documents (plans, specifications, submittals) to confirm best practices and program or code compliance. Communicate recommendations to stakeholders.
  3. Perform analysis including takeoffs from construction drawings and calculating energy savings.
  4. Complete site inspections and performance testing to verify program requirements. Effectively communicate recommendations or corrections to construction trades in the field.
  5. Accurately document building measures as required for building certification or code.

About Steven Winter Associates, Inc. 
Steven Winter Associates, Inc. (SWA) provides research, consulting and advisory services to improve commercial, residential and multifamily built environments for private and public sector clients. We specialize in energy, sustainability and accessibility consulting as well as certification, research & development and compliance services. Our team of professionals has led the way since 1972 in the development of best practices to achieve high performance buildings.
